What is a 20ft Container?
A 20-foot container, typically described as a TEU (Twenty-foot Equivalent Unit), is a standardized shipping container. It is mainly utilized for the intermodal transportation of goods and can be quickly transferred in between ships, trucks, and trains. The internal dimensions of a 20ft container typically determine around 19 feet 4 inches in length, 7 feet 8 inches in width, and 7 feet 10 inches in height.
Typical Weights
The weight of a 20ft container can differ based upon its style and meant usage. There are normally three primary weight categories to think about: Tare Weight, Maximum Gross Weight, and Payload Capacity.
Table 1: Weight Specifications of a Standard 20ft ContainerWeight CategoryWeight (pounds)Weight (kg)Tare Weight4,5002,041Optimum Gross Weight56,00025,401Payload Capacity51,50023,360Tare Weight: This is the weight of the empty container itself. Usually, a 20ft New Shipping Container basic container weighs around 4,500 pounds (2,041 kg). Optimum Gross Weight: This shows the maximum total weight that the container can safely carry throughout transport, consisting of the weight of the container and the load. For a 20ft Open Top Shipping Containers container, this is typically about 56,000 lbs (25,401 kg).Payload Capacity: The payload capability describes the maximum weight of the freight that can be loaded into the container. This is the difference between the optimum gross weight and the tare weight, leading to an approximate payload capability of 51,500 pounds (23,360 kg).Factors Influencing the Weight of a 20ft Container

Understanding and accurately determining container weights is important for compliance with international shipping regulations. Surpassing the optimum gross weight can lead to fines and charges, prospective damage to the transportation automobile, and logistical complications.

For example, the International Maritime Organization (IMO) needs that the Verified Gross Mass (VGM) of a container be interacted before packing it onto a ship. The VGM is determined using 2 acceptable approaches:
Weighing the crammed container utilizing qualified equipmentWeighing the freight and any additional packaging materials, and then including this to the tare weight of the containerPractical Implications
